The correct answer is North to South.

Key Points

  • The Western Ghats run parallel to India's west coast from Gujarat to Kerala.
  • Their elevation progressively increases from north to south, culminating in Anai Mudi (2695 m) in Kerala — the highest peak in peninsular India.
